Typically, a 5-panel drug test in Neosho Falls, KS utilizes a urine sample, as it provides a reliable snapshot of recent drug use. However, advancements in testing technology have made saliva and hair test versions available as well. Each method has its strengths; urine tests are cost-effective, saliva tests offer convenience and quick results, while hair tests provide a longer detection window, making them suitable for varied testing needs.
In Neosho Falls, KS, the 5-panel drug test specifically targets five major drug classes: marijuana, cocaine, opiates, amphetamines, and phencyclidine (PCP). | Panel | Drugs Covered |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| 5-Panel | THC, Cocaine, Opiates, Amphetamines, PCP | Baseline employment screening |
| 7-Panel | 5-panel + Barbiturates, Benzodiazepines | Healthcare & safety-sensitive roles |
| 10-Panel | 7-panel + Methadone, Propoxyphene, Quaaludes* | Expanded coverage (role-specific) |

Ranges vary by substance, frequency of use, metabolism, body mass, dosage, hydration, and lab cutoff levels.
| Drug | Urine | Hair | Blood | Nails |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Marijuana (THC) | 1-30 days | Up to 90 days | 2-3 days | Up to 3-6 months |
| Cocaine | 2-4 days | Up to 90 days | 1-2 days | Up to 3-6 months |
| Opiates (Codeine, Morphine, Heroin) | 1-3 days | Up to 90 days | Up to 24 hours | Up to 3-6 months |
| Amphetamines (incl. Methamphetamine) | 1-3 days | Up to 90 days | 1-2 days | Up to 3-6 months |
| PCP (Phencyclidine) | 1-7 days | Up to 90 days | 1-3 days | Up to 3-6 months |
Screening at SAMHSA-certified laboratories with confirmatory GC/MS or LC-MS/MS testing as needed.
Every non-negative screen is reviewed by a Medical Review Officer. Chain-of-Custody Form (CCF) maintained end-to-end. DOT collections and results reporting follow 49 CFR Part 40 when specified by the employer/order.

Kansas, located in the heart of the United States, is known for its vast landscapes, significant agricultural output, and vibrant culture. It gained statehood in 1861, becoming the 34th state to join the Union.
The population of Kansas, as recorded in recent estimates, stands at approximately 2.9 million. The state capital is Topeka, while Wichita is recognized as the largest city, serving as a cultural and economic hub.
Agriculture plays a pivotal role in Kansas's economy, with the state being a leading producer of wheat, corn, and soybeans. Additionally, Kansas's central location makes it a crucial transport and logistics center.
Rich in heritage, Kansas boasts numerous historical sites and natural wonders, such as the Tallgrass Prairie National Preserve and the Amelia Earhart Museum, attracting tourists from around the world.
